Derek G. Land is a scholar working on Animal Science and Zoology, Nutrition and Dietetics and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Derek G. Land has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 981 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Animal Science and Zoology, 9 papers in Nutrition and Dietetics and 8 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Derek G. Land’s work include Animal Nutrition and Physiology (9 papers), Sodium Intake and Health (4 papers) and Biochemical Analysis and Sensing Techniques (4 papers). Derek G. Land is often cited by papers focused on Animal Nutrition and Physiology (9 papers), Sodium Intake and Health (4 papers) and Biochemical Analysis and Sensing Techniques (4 papers). Derek G. Land coll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Italy. Derek G. Land's co-authors include R. F. Curtis, A. Hobson‐Frohock, Nerys M. Griffiths, T. W. Goodwin, Richard Shepherd, C.A. Farleigh, G. Roger Fenwick, David S. Robinson, Jennifer M. Gee and E.J. Butler and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ry and Sensors.
